About Ben Warner
Ben Warner serves as the Senior Director of IT Service and Infrastructure at AtriCure, Inc., where he has worked since 2023. He holds an MBA from Xavier University and has extensive experience in IT management across various industries, including healthcare and pharmaceuticals.

Professional Background
Ben Warner has a diverse professional background with extensive experience in IT management and infrastructure. He began his career as an Information Technology Manager for the City of Fairfield from 1998 to 2006. He then held various managerial and director roles at organizations such as Health Alliance, Amylin Pharmaceuticals, Hobsons, MCPc, and Henny Penny, where he focused on systems support and information technology management.
